About A. V. Sedelnikov

A. V. Sedelnikov is a scholar working on Computational Mechanics, Astronomy and Astrophysics and Aerospace Engineering, having authored 71 papers that have together received 487 indexed citations. Recurring topics across this work include Field-Flow Fractionation Techniques (41 papers), Planetary Science and Exploration (16 papers) and Spacecraft Design and Technology (11 papers). The work is most often cited by research in Computational Mechanics (285 citations), Astronomy and Astrophysics (176 citations) and Aerospace Engineering (262 citations). A. V. Sedelnikov has collaborated with scholars based in Russia. Frequent co-authors include А. С. Филиппов, Vadim Manusov, А. В. Гаврилов, Р. В. Скиданов and В. Г. Смелов.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Sensors.
